Castleton Commodities International LLC is hiring!
Description:
CCI is hiring a Data Engineer for our US development team to help advance our Reporting & Data Analytics platform by building and improving finance-focused data pipelines and broader data management capabilities.
Responsibilities: - Architect, develop, and maintain robust and scalable data pipelines, ensuring the integrity and availability of data for analysis and reporting.
- Analyze source data to identify patterns, anomalies, and opportunities for data enrichment, ensuring comprehensive understanding for effective data modeling.
- Design and implement data models that support complex financial analysis, integrating Data Quality measures to ensure the accuracy and reliability of data products.
- Perform ongoing data management tasks, including data mapping, standardization, and normalization to facilitate consistent data consumption.
- Engage in research to stay abreast of the latest trends and best practices in data management, big data, AI, and vendor solutions.
- Lead the migration of existing datasets, databases, and codebases to modern and scalable technology stacks.
- Monitor data loads, troubleshoot errors, establish efficient data workflows, and conduct data quality analyses to identify and resolve systemic issues.
- Proactively manage vendor relationships and anticipate changes in data inputs to maintain data product relevance.
- Collaborate with global teams to understand and document data flows, architecture, and functional requirements, ensuring alignment with business objectives.
Qualifications: - Bachelor's degree in computer science,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, or a related field of study.
- 5+ years of experience in Data Engineering with experience in energy commodities or financial services.
- Strong analytics skills with demonstrated attention to detail.
- Superb communication skills and ability to interact with all levels of management.
- Ability to perform under pressure with a high motivation/energy level and manage multiple tasks to established deadlines. Demonstrated successful management of projects
- Demonstrable expertise in programming with a strong command of SQL and Python.
- Proficient with orchestration tools such as Autosys and Airflow, with the ability to design and manage automated data workflows.
- Hands-on experience with modern data transformation tools, including DBT (Data Build Tool), AWS Redshift or other cloud-based data warehouse solution and Airflow, showcasing skills in efficiently transforming and processing large datasets.
- Solid repository management experience, with a deep understanding of CI/CD pipeline processes, version control systems, and best practices in code deployment and integration.
- Knowledgeable in implementing automated testing and Data Quality (DQ) frameworks, ensuring the reliability and integrity of data solutions.
- Experience with cloud-based data warehouse environment with emphasis on managing and optimizing data for reporting and analysis.
- Adept at troubleshooting, optimising data processes, and resolving complex data engineering challenges.
- Familiarity with Business intelligence tools Power BI and Tableau.
